How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Mission Viejo?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Mission Viejo Studio Apartments | $2,485 | $1,895 | $3,692 |
| Mission Viejo 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,819 | $2,099 | $5,035 |
| Mission Viejo 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,420 | $2,400 | $5,884 |
| Mission Viejo 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,517 | $3,749 | $6,375 |
